Transaction 96f6d2258087e2e191a8159074993c349aa65de78b4f3dc148656d19dd8a8f83

104 Input
2 Outputs
  • 96f6d2258087e2e191a8159074993c349aa65de78b4f3dc148656d19dd8a8f83:0
  • value  102732230
    address  3MKyC2eLJ1EepBvnUrcWhVSQmg5BHNFt8H
  • 96f6d2258087e2e191a8159074993c349aa65de78b4f3dc148656d19dd8a8f83:1
  • value  1000000
    address  3GynycG6vL9FBPUbUombQKBQVUgMWX7Jxg